Selecting a Name for Your Alaskan LLC


Your LLC’s name lays the foundation for your enterprise brand in Alaska. You’ll want a name that’s unique, easy to remember, and meets Alaska’s laws.

Start by checking the Alaska Corporations Database to verify your chosen name isn’t already in use. Don’t forget, your moniker must contain “Limited Liability Company,” “LLC,” or an accepted abbreviation.

Avoid words that might mislead your enterprise with a official department. If you’ve found the suitable name, you can hold it for 120 days with the Alaska Division of Corporations.

This step grants you a window to organize without worrying about missing out on your preferred name.

 

 

Selecting an Alaskan Registered Agent


Every Alaska LLC needs a registered agent—a entity or business appointed to get legal documents and official notices for your company.

You can select yourself, another person, or a registered agent service, as long as the agent has a street address in Alaska and is present during standard office times. P.O. boxes aren’t accepted.

Make an informed choice about someone reliable; overlooking an important notice can have major consequences. Many business owners choose professional registered agent services for simplicity and privacy.

 

 

Submitting Articles of Organization in Alaska


Submitting the Articles of Organization is a essential step in creating your Alaska LLC.

You’ll need to submit this documentation to the Alaska Division of Corporations, Business and Professional Licensing, whether online or by mail.

List your LLC’s designation, registered agent’s contact and primary office address, as well as the individuals involved.

Confirm your data for precision before dispatching.

There’s a state filing fee, so don’t forget your payment.

After the state validates your Articles of Organization, your LLC comes into being.

Be sure to archive your official papers for your documentation and any potential business needs.

 

 

Creating an Operating Agreement


While Alaska doesn't mandate an operating agreement for LLCs, drafting this document is a sensible move.

An business agreement defines your LLC’s equity distribution, management roles, and member duties, helping avoid misunderstandings down the road. You’ll use it to define how you’ll divide income, handle member inputs, and settle disagreements between members.

If your LLC has more than one member, a well-written agreement secures everyone’s interests. Even for a sole-member company, it delineates separation between individual and company assets.

Consider Alaska-specific examples as a baseline, then tailor details to align with your business’s distinctive goals and member expectations.
